has the slander/division argument been used to keep people who know things, (but love God and don’t want to hurt his church) quiet?

One of your questions on has a GCM church used the label of divisive to keep people from questioning or rasing concerns? Yes. Because of there quest for unity w/in small groups, church, movement, and the pressure that was put on me to not cause waves in that my questions were silenced for a time by being labeled divisive and not good for the benefit of the people I cared about. A fear of being shunned, etc. kept me from speaking out more for along time until my questions and pain could not be kept silent anymore, asked for a few more questions and quickly found the door shown to me by my leaders telling me how divisive my comments could be to their small group and to the church. After words I have been pressured not necissairly from leadership, but from my GCM friends not to dig anymore as they see what I am doing as only looking to create division. I know that as other people have spoken up on these issues, this divisive card has been pulled along with other viscious attacks on the character of those who are raising concerns as they leave GCM churches. I know that this is happening in effort to get them to cease to raise concerns.
